From de6b12502cdf42d5d92118f1c0e38dc31becf7c5 Mon Sep 17 00:00:00 2001 From: Rene Mayrhofer Date: Tue, 23 Feb 2010 10:42:46 +0000 Subject: Updated to new upstream release. interfaces Patch is not from upstream. --- m4/macros/enable-disable.m4 | 32 ++++++++++++++++++++++++++++++++ m4/macros/with.m4 | 24 ++++++++++++++++++++++++ 2 files changed, 56 insertions(+) create mode 100644 m4/macros/enable-disable.m4 create mode 100644 m4/macros/with.m4 (limited to 'm4/macros') diff --git a/m4/macros/enable-disable.m4 b/m4/macros/enable-disable.m4 new file mode 100644 index 000000000..6d7959e4e --- /dev/null +++ b/m4/macros/enable-disable.m4 @@ -0,0 +1,32 @@ + +# ARG_ENABL_SET(option, help) +# --------------------------- +# Create a --enable-$1 option with helptext, set a variable $1 to true/false +AC_DEFUN([ARG_ENABL_SET], + [AC_ARG_ENABLE( + [$1], + AS_HELP_STRING([--enable-$1], [$2]), + [if test x$enableval = xyes; then + patsubst([$1], [-], [_])=true + else + patsubst([$1], [-], [_])=false + fi], + patsubst([$1], [-], [_])=false + )] +) + +# ARG_DISBL_SET(option, help) +# --------------------------- +# Create a --disable-$1 option with helptext, set a variable $1 to true/false +AC_DEFUN([ARG_DISBL_SET], + [AC_ARG_ENABLE( + [$1], + AS_HELP_STRING([--disable-$1], [$2]), + [if test x$enableval = xyes; then + patsubst([$1], [-], [_])=true + else + patsubst([$1], [-], [_])=false + fi], + patsubst([$1], [-], [_])=true + )] +) diff --git a/m4/macros/with.m4 b/m4/macros/with.m4 new file mode 100644 index 000000000..908333b47 --- /dev/null +++ b/m4/macros/with.m4 @@ -0,0 +1,24 @@ + +# ARG_WITH_SUBST(option, default, help) +# ----------------------------------- +# Create a --with-$1 option with helptext, AC_SUBST($1) to $withval/default +AC_DEFUN([ARG_WITH_SUBST], + [AC_ARG_WITH( + [$1], + AS_HELP_STRING([--with-$1=arg], [$3 (default: $2).]), + [AC_SUBST(patsubst([$1], [-], [_]), ["$withval"])], + [AC_SUBST(patsubst([$1], [-], [_]), ["$2"])] + )] +) + +# ARG_WITH_SET(option, default, help) +# ----------------------------------- +# Create a --with-$1 option with helptext, set a variable $1 to $withval/default +AC_DEFUN([ARG_WITH_SET], + [AC_ARG_WITH( + [$1], + AS_HELP_STRING([--with-$1=arg], [$3 (default: $2).]), + patsubst([$1], [-], [_])="$withval", + patsubst([$1], [-], [_])=$2 + )] +) -- cgit v1.2.3